Jim Gaspard, a member of the Saddle Tramps student spirit organization, created the original design for the Raider Red costume, basing it on a character created by cartoonist Dirk West, a Texas Tech alumnus and former Lubbock mayor. Games, 1 The Green Bay Packers and Chicago Bears have Texas Tech Two years prior to the stadium's opening, Clifford B. Jones, former Texas Tech University president, established a $100,000 trust toward construction for a new football stadium. In 1932, Texas Tech joined the Border Intercollegiate Athletic Association, also known as the Border Conference.
